0% ont trouvé ce document utile (0 vote)
204 vues1 page

Applications Réparties : Concepts et Technologies

Ce document décrit le programme d'un cours sur les applications réparties. Le programme couvre de nombreux sujets comme les bases de données distribuées, les transactions, les architectures distribuées et la distribution sur Internet.

Transféré par

ramzi esprims
Copyright
© © All Rights Reserved
Nous prenons très au sérieux les droits relatifs au contenu. Si vous pensez qu’il s’agit de votre contenu, signalez une atteinte au droit d’auteur ici.
Formats disponibles
Téléchargez aux formats PDF, TXT ou lisez en ligne sur Scribd
0% ont trouvé ce document utile (0 vote)
204 vues1 page

Applications Réparties : Concepts et Technologies

Ce document décrit le programme d'un cours sur les applications réparties. Le programme couvre de nombreux sujets comme les bases de données distribuées, les transactions, les architectures distribuées et la distribution sur Internet.

Transféré par

ramzi esprims
Copyright
© © All Rights Reserved
Nous prenons très au sérieux les droits relatifs au contenu. Si vous pensez qu’il s’agit de votre contenu, signalez une atteinte au droit d’auteur ici.
Formats disponibles
Téléchargez aux formats PDF, TXT ou lisez en ligne sur Scribd

MATIERE: Applications réparties

Année:2 Semestre:2
Coefficient : 1.5 CI TP
Total heures : 33 21 12

OBJECTIF: Donner une vision globale des applications réparties, de la


distribution de services et de données à travers l'ensemble des
technologies existantes et coopérantes en entreprise.

PROGRAMME:  Introduction à la distribution


Objectifs des architectures distribuées.
Les différentes formes de distribution : données, applications,
services le concept client/serveur et son évolution
 Bases de données distribuées et fédérées
Etude de la distribution des bases de données, des
mécanismes de réplication et de fédération de bases de
données hétérogènes.
 Systèmes transactionnels
Notion de transaction. Etude des propriétés ACID. Principes
d'un système transactionnel, système de validation à 2 phases.
 Architectures Distribuées
Etude des différents modèles de distribution. Notions de RPC,
de MARSHALLING et des mécanismes de requêtes
distribuées. Modèle Client/serveur et architectures multi-tiers.
Distributions des objets et normes et standards existants :
CORBA, COM/DCOM
Le problème de la sécurité en environnement distribué.
Les infrastructures applicatives- Le framework .net : asp.net,
ado.net, composants .netJEE : servlet, .jsp, composants EJB,
JMS, RMI
 La distribution sur réseaux Internet
L'architecture Multi-tiers.
Les mécanismes de distribution sur internet :
Serveurs WEB, Les serveurs d'applications, la programmation
par script : PHP, ASP et ASP. NET, accès aux bases de
données.
Les WEB services : notions d'architecture. Principes de
fonctionnement et la distribution inter-applicative.
BIBLIOGRAPHIE Georges GARDARIN : Bases de données EYROLLES
Jean Pierre MEINADIER : Le métier d'intégration de systèmes
HERMES
Hubert KADIMA Valérie MONTFORT : Les WEB SERVICES
DUNOD
Jérôme LAFOSSE : Développement d'applications n-tiers avec
JAVA EE, Edition ENI

58

Vous aimerez peut-être aussi